MissionWired is looking for a Senior Data Engineer to structure client data for effective and efficient querying and advanced segmentation, supporting various causes from electing Democrats to combating climate change.
Requirements
- Experience with and advanced knowledge of SQL;
- Experience with Civis or similar data warehouse systems;
- Ability to build and optimize data pipelines, architectures, and data sets;
- Knowledge of Python;
- Experience with DBT;
Responsibilities
- Building SQL pipelines to extract, transform, and load data sets from a variety of internal and external data sources;
- Architecting data systems;
- Working in client systems such as Salesforce and Civis and transferring data between them;
- Creating SQL queries against data tables to enable advanced segmentation for direct mail campaigns;
- Structuring data to enable effective and efficient querying and segmentation;
- Assembling large and complex data sets that meet project needs;
- Using an array of technological languages and tools to connect systems and move data;
Other
- 4+ years of professional experience;
- Attention to detail;
- Curiosity to innovate on ways to solve data management issues;
- Passion, energy, and excitement for progressive and philanthropic causes.
- Supporting your team on some nights and weekends as we approach high-volume times such as elections may be required.